Self-emptying
You can reduce time and energy by using a robot vacuum that is able to automatically empty itself. The docking station is equipped with large storage bags that, when full, can be taken off and replaced. It takes away the need to empty the tiny dustbin that is on the robot, and can reduce the health and hygiene risks associated with contact with dust and pet hair. It also stops the bin from being full, which can lead to the loss of vacuum and possibly spitting debris into the living space.
It is worth considering a robot vacuum that will be automatically emptied in the event that you have relatives who suffer from allergies or hay fever. This can prevent dirt from getting back into your home. It's also a great choice for those who have an active lifestyle and wish to be able to spend less time cleaning their home.

Obstacle avoidance
Object avoidance technology helps robots steer clear of household clutter and debris when they clean. It stops them from slurping anything that will jam or damage internal components, and it keeps you from having to pull stuck objects out of their suction or move them under furniture. Many newer models of robot vacuum cleaner uk vacuums and other smart home appliances are now equipped with high-tech obstacle avoidance technology that works in real-time.
When you're shopping for the top robot vacuums, make sure you select one with the latest obstacle detection systems that operate in a variety lighting conditions and can recognize many different objects. Top smart robots are equipped with a variety of sensors that aid in gaining a better understanding of their surroundings. They can also avoid obstacles when the space's layout changes. Examples of the most advanced obstacle avoidance techniques include crossed IR sensors and 3D structured light and ToF (time of flight) sensors.
Crossed IR sensor beams are light beams that are focused that are reflected off objects, which aids the robot to recognize them. This type sensor is used extensively in robot vacuums and other cleaning robots and is especially efficient in dark rooms. Certain more expensive robots have 3D structured light, which emits an array of light pulses and uses the way they're distorted in order to detect surrounding objects. 3D structured light is typically combined with cameras and crossed IR sensors to provide an all-encompassing obstacle-avoiding system.
Cameras are a different technology that is popular for robot vacuums and mopping bots. They can be monocular or binocular and can capture images of the surrounding environment and then use image processing to identify obstacles. The top robotic vacuums equipped with camera sensors offer a more comprehensive solution for obstacle avoidance and can be combined with other technologies to produce better results.
One of the most advanced obstacle avoidance systems is offered by the iRobot Roomba J7+. It comes with a built-in camera and can recognize objects of various dimensions, including pet waste. iRobot's confidence in this technology is so steadfast that it provides a "Pet Poop Promise" guarantee: if the robot encounters pet waste the company will replace the device without cost to customers.
